WebOct 11, 2024 · Bureaucratic leadership is a leadership style that follows a hierarchy where formal duties are fixed. Leaders using this approach function per official rules set by superiors within the company. Employees under this leadership follow specific authority and regulations developed by their managers. WebSep 10, 2024 · To Christensen , bureaucratic autonomy is the formal exemption from full supervision by the concerned political actors (e.g., departmental minister). The presence of formalization criterion in the definition implies that the exemption from political oversight should be established through properly enacted legal mechanisms.
